Job Description
Ref KFS/RMOII/2022
Job Specifications
An officer at this level shall report to Head Registries.
Duties and responsibilities
- Ensuring security of information, documents, files and office equipment
- Supervision of the registry; sorting and classifying documents for filing.
- Storage, updating and maintenance of personnel records and file index
- Controlling opening of open, confidential and secret files
- Custody and Maintenance of KFS documents; ensuring security of information and Records in a registry/archives.
- Ensuring mail are received, sorted, opened, and dispatched and related registers are maintained
- Planning appropriate office accommodation for registries;
- Ensuring that file movement records are. Updated and maintained; overseeing security of files and documents;
- Ensuring receipt and proper dispatch of mails and maintaining related
- Digitizing KFS documents for circulation and archiving.
- Promote public values and principles
- Mentoring and coaching
Person Specif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in any of the following disciplines: – Information Science Management, Records Management or any of the Social Sciences plus a Certificate in Records Management/Information Management or other relevant and equivalent qualifications from a recognized Institution;
- Proficiency in Computer applications
